.elementor-5332 .elementor-element.elementor-element-9d5d7a3{--spacer-size:89px;}.elementor-5332 .elementor-element.elementor-element-31e1c51{--spacer-size:50px;}.elementor-widget-text-editor{font-family:var( --e-global-typography-text-font-family ), Sans-serif;font-weight:var( --e-global-typography-text-font-weight );color:var( --e-global-color-text );}.elementor-widget-text-editor.elementor-drop-cap-view-stacked .elementor-drop-cap{background-color:var( --e-global-color-primary );}.elementor-widget-text-editor.elementor-drop-cap-view-framed .elementor-drop-cap, .elementor-widget-text-editor.elementor-drop-cap-view-default .elementor-drop-cap{color:var( --e-global-color-primary );border-color:var( --e-global-color-primary );}.elementor-5332 .elementor-element.elementor-element-6717d27{text-align:center;font-family:"Bitter", Sans-serif;font-size:68px;font-weight:700;color:#4B14B470;}.elementor-5332 .elementor-element.elementor-element-50e88a2{--spacer-size:50px;}.elementor-widget-image .widget-image-caption{color:var( --e-global-color-text );font-family:var( --e-global-typography-text-font-family ), Sans-serif;font-weight:var( --e-global-typography-text-font-weight );}.elementor-5332 .elementor-element.elementor-element-2de2667{--spacer-size:50px;}.elementor-5332 .elementor-element.elementor-element-95e7da7{--spacer-size:50px;}.elementor-5332 .elementor-element.elementor-element-acb9c76{--spacer-size:50px;}.elementor-5332 .elementor-element.elementor-element-df0e58a{--spacer-size:50px;}.elementor-5332 .elementor-element.elementor-element-33b2cbe{--spacer-size:50px;}@media(max-width:767px){.elementor-5332 .elementor-element.elementor-element-6717d27{line-height:0.9em;}}/* Start custom CSS *//* Full-page slow cloud animation */
/* To change the speed, edit the value in '300s'. 
   Bigger number = slower. Smaller number = faster.
   Examples: 150s = fast, 300s = slow, 500s = very slow. */

body {
  background-image: url("https://www.festival-mantra-joie.fr/wp-content/uploads/2025/11/38266262-5956-4784-99a9-b38deecaa709.png");
  background-repeat: repeat-x;
  background-size: cover;

  /* Change '300s' here for speed */
  animation: cloudsPage 200s linear infinite;
}

@keyframes cloudsPage {
  0% { background-position: 0 0; }
  100% { background-position: -2500px 0; }
}/* End custom CSS */